**FAQ: Why can't I use the lifts on weekends?**

Good question — every weekend the maintenance team from Quillard Vertical services the lifts at Harrowgate Point, usually Saturday 7am to Sunday 2pm. Lift 4 stays running for accessibility, but expect a wait. If you're booking weekend meetings for your exec, steer them to the second floor or below and suggest the stairs. Team assistants escorting weekend visitors should use the side entrance on Marlin Walk, which needs a pass. The current weekend door code is below:

turnstile pass: bdg-TXR-4

**Ticket: SproutCycle vault locked after failed rotation**

The credentials vault for the SproutCycle plant-watering scheduler locked itself after three bad unlock attempts during Friday's deploy. Watering jobs are still running on cached tokens, but those expire Thursday. Raising for the weekly eng sync so we can unseal it together. Unsealing requires the recovery passphrase noted below.

strongbox words: briiel-zoreth-noveth-pelys-druwyn-feniel-lamvan-ulaius-kasion

Ticket: Staging env misconfigured for Siftgate bloom filter

The bloom layer in front of the Pellet KV store is rejecting all lookups in staging because the env file was copied from the dev template without credentials. False-positive tuning values are fine; only the auth line is missing. To unblock the weekly demo, the Pellet admission secret must be set on the following line.

env line for yaguf-fajop: LEDGER_TOKEN13=fb08984397349

// Per-tenant rate quotas for the Ombrella ingest client.
// Each tenant gets a 500 req/min budget, enforced server-side by the
// quota service; the client also throttles locally to avoid burst 429s.
// Quota overrides must go through the capacity review discussed at the
// weekly sync — do not hardcode exceptions here.
// The quota service authenticates requests with the internal service
// key that appears directly below this comment.

API key for tagef-fafop: vxb2-ta